IVV vs SMMV
iShares Core S&P 500 ETF vs iShares MSCI USA Small-Cap Minimum Volatility Factor ETF
Which is better, IVV or SMMV?
Large Cap Blend against Small Cap Blend.
IVV has a lower expense ratio. IVV led over 1Y, 3Y, 5Y and the full window. SMMV is less concentrated, with 12.5% of the fund in its ten largest positions against 37.9%.

IVV vs SMMV Performance
iShares Core S&P 500 ETF (IVV) is an ETF from iShares by BlackRock (US) and iShares MSCI USA Small-Cap Minimum Volatility Factor ETF (SMMV) is an ETF from iShares by BlackRock (US). Over the past year IVV returned +17.57% while SMMV returned +9.55%. Year to date, IVV is up 11.57% versus a gain of 7.79% for SMMV.
Over three years, IVV compounded at +20.71% per year against +13.05% for SMMV; over five years the annualized figures are +12.80% and +5.90% respectively. Across the full 10-year window we track, IVV has the edge at +14.38% annualized vs +7.65%.

Risk: Volatility and Drawdowns
IVV has been the more volatile fund, with annualized monthly volatility of 15.4% compared with 13.7% for SMMV. Lower volatility generally means a smoother ride, though it often comes with lower long-run returns.
The deepest peak-to-trough decline in our data was -33.9% for IVV and -38.8% for SMMV. Drawdown depth is what each fund did in the worst stretch of the window measured above.
The two funds' monthly returns correlate at 0.82. They usually move together, but the gap leaves some room for diversification.
Fees and Cost Over Time
IVV charges 0.03% per year while SMMV charges 0.20%. On a $10,000 position that is $3 vs $20 annually, a gap of $17 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, IVV currently yields 1.06% against 1.65% for SMMV.
Holdings Overlap
0.4% of IVV's money is in holdings SMMV also owns. 5.6% of SMMV's money is in holdings IVV also owns.
SMMV and IVV share little of their money.
15 positions in common, counted across the 505 positions we hold weights for in IVV and 349 in SMMV, against full books of 508 and 369.
What only one of them owns
Our book lists 319 positions for SMMV that do not appear in our book for IVV (90.5% of the fund), and 480 for IVV that do not appear in SMMV (98.9%).
Some of those will be the same company recorded under a different code in one of the two books, so the real difference in what you would own is no larger than this and may be smaller. We do not name the individual positions here for that reason.
